Skada Damage Meter
Skada Damage Meter
Skada is a modular damage meter for World of Warcraft with various viewing modes, segmented fights, and customizable windows. It is designed for efficiency with minimal memory and CPU impact.
"Skada" is Swedish for "Damage".

Usage
Getting Started
A default window is created upon first load. Access the configuration menu by clicking the cog icon on the window title bar or via the minimap button. Select Configure to access settings.
Multiple Windows
Skada supports multiple windows. Create new ones under the Windows section of the configuration panel. Windows can be:
- Bar: The standard customizable meter.
- Inline: A horizontal line for custom UI setups.
- Data Text: For LDB displays and minimal setups.
Navigation
- Left-Click: View more detailed information.
- Right-Click: Return to the previous view.
- Mousewheel: Scroll through lists.
- Tooltips: Hover over bars to see additional context and shortcut keys (e.g., Shift-click for targets).
Themes
Manage window designs with the built-in Theme Engine. You can import and export themes by using theme strings.

Posted Aug 25, 2016Skada ends the segment when you exit combat, which normally only happens when you or the mob you attacked is dead.
Training dummies are an exception because they won't keep you in combat for dots, you have to continue to actively attack them - otherwise combat will end and Skada will stop aggregating dot damage. Try your test again with your character auto-attacking the dummy until the dot falls off.
